Master (MSc) Computer Science in Germany
Program start date | Application deadline |
- | - |
- | - |
Program Overview
Master (MSc) Computer Science in Germany
Overview
Elevate your tech expertise and immerse yourself in the thriving digital landscape with our accredited Master's in Computer Science in Germany. At IU International University of Applied Sciences, you’ll experience an optimal blend of online and on-campus learning, designed to deepen your scientific knowledge and technical skills.
Study Contents
The Master's in Computer Science programme at IU has been meticulously designed to equip you with next-gen technological expertise, ensuring you stay at the forefront of innovation in the ever-evolving digital landscape. Our curriculum is up to date with industry requirements and encapsulates a blend of theoretical concepts and hands-on exposure.
Semester 1
- Master the dynamic language Python.
- Gain in-depth knowledge of software processes.
- Dive into advanced mathematics and statistics.
- The foundation built in this semester will enable you to grasp complex algorithms easily and effectively analyze big data.
Module | ECTS credits ---------|------------- Programming with Python | 5 Software Engineering: Software Processes | 5 Advanced Mathematics | 5 Advanced Statistics | 5 Data Science | 5 Project: Software Engineering | 5
Semester 2
- Explore advanced algorithmics.
- Learn about cyber security and data protection.
- Understand the role of AI in today's industries.
By the end of this semester, you will be equipped to handle security threats and use AI in problem-solving.
Module | ECTS credits ---------|------------- Algorithmics | 5 Cyber Security and Data Protection | 5 Seminar: Computer Science and Society | 5 Artificial Intelligence | 5 Big Data Technologies | 5 Project: Computer Science Project | 5
Semester 3
- Delve deep into distributed systems and networks.
- Choose two electives to broaden your skills in your preferred domain.
The skills acquired at this stage prime you for a successful career in niche technology domains.
Module | ECTS credits ---------|------------- Seminar: Current Topics in Computer Science | 5 Networks and Distributed Systems | 5 Electives A | 10 Electives B | 10
Semester 4
- Work on your Master’s thesis.
Upon completion, your robust technical knowledge base will position you to conquer technical challenges in the dynamic digital industry.
Module | ECTS credits ---------|------------- Master Thesis | 30
Electives Overview
Our elective pool allows you to personalize your curriculum, choosing modules that best mirror your career goals. Whether it's advanced cyber security, quantum computing, or deep learning - tailor your learning journey with IU to your preferred specialization.
Module | ECTS credits ---------|------------- Electives A: Advanced Cyber Security and Cryptology | 10 Blockchain and Quantum Computing | 10 IT Governance and Service Management | 10 UI/UX Expert | 10 Electives B: Data Engineer | 10 Business Analyst | 10 Technical Project Lead | 10 Machine Learning and Deep Learning | 10 Use Case Identification and Evaluation for Analytical Applications | 10 Internship | 10
Career
The digital sector in Germany is strong and ever-expanding, making it an exciting place for computer science master's graduates. Ranked as one of Europe's top technology hubs, Germany has an insatiable demand for savvy tech graduates across emerging and established tech domains. Specifically, areas like artificial intelligence, big data, cyber security, and software engineering are teeming with opportunities.
Cyber Security Analyst
As a Cyber Security Analyst, you'll work as the frontline defense against potential security threats. Your role will encompass identifying and mitigating risks, monitoring system activity, and implementing necessary protection measures. A strong grasp of cryptography, network security, and advanced systems is essential for success in this role.
Data Scientist
As a Data Scientist, you possess the analytical knowledge to glean insights from raw data. You will cleanse, integrate, and analyze big data sets to inform business strategies. Your expertise in statistical modeling and predictive analytics makes you an invaluable asset to a broad range of industries.
Artificial Intelligence Specialist
As an Artificial Intelligence Specialist, you're at the forefront of emerging technologies, designing and implementing intelligent systems. You'll utilize your skills in machine learning, deep learning, and predictive modeling to optimize business processes, automate tasks, or build new product features. This role is pivotal in the current digital transformation age.
Fees
At IU, we believe in full transparency – so there are no hidden fees. You only pay for your tuition and the one-time campus registration fee of €1,500.
FULL-TIME
Duration: 24 Months
Participate in real-time tutorials with tutors and a small group of students, while still having maximum flexibility to combine work and studies.
Tuition Fees: 556€ (530€ per month)
Recognition of previous achievements
Have you already completed a training course, studied at a university, or gained work experience? Have you completed a course or a learning path through IU LinkedIn Learning, and earned a certificate? Then you have the opportunity to get your previous achievements recognized, and complete your studies at IU sooner.
Admission Requirement
You can start your desired study program at IU International University of Applied Sciences if you meet the requirements.
General admission requirements
- Completed, undergraduate degree with 180 ECTS credits with a focus on Computer Science or computer-related subjects
- Your degree must be from a state or state-recognized higher education institution/university
- You must have achieved a final grade of at least “satisfactory” or Grade C equivalent in your previous undergraduate degree
English language skills
We accept the following English language skills certificates:
- TOEFL (minimum 80 points)
- IELTS (minimum Level 6)
- Duolingo English Test (minimum 95 points)
- Cambridge Certificate (minimum Grade B)
Proof must not be older than five years.
Alternative ways to prove your English language skills:
- Educational background: If your previous studies were conducted in English, you are exempt from providing an official test. Simply submit your high school or university transcripts indicating that English was the language of instruction, or provide a medium of instruction letter. Note: A high school medium of instruction letter is valid for five years, while a university-issued one has no expiration date.
- If you are from a country where English is the official and educational language, your passport can serve as proof of English proficiency.